Join us at MAP for a talk by the British sculptor, Stephen Cox whose sculptures of Yoginis and Rishis carved in basalt greet audiences as they enter the museum. Reflecting on his journey so far, Cox will talk about his practice, inspirations and earlier works that led him from his home in the UK to Italy and India and later still to Egypt where he continues to make sculpture.

Since 1985, when he first visited by invitation of the British Council, Cox has spent a considerable amount of time working in India. Drawing from Cox’s observations of architectural sites and monuments in Mahabalipuram, Dialogues in Stone, his exhibition at MAP embodies mythical beings through minimalist forms. 

Join us as Cox explores the narratives embedded within stones and gives us a glimpse into his process of bringing these stories to life.
